Work description

As part of the West Midlands Combined Authority (WMCA) One Public Estate (OPE) programme City of Wolverhampton Council (CWC) are leading the development of a business case for the creation of a Public Sector Hub (PSH) on the Broad Street site in Wolverhampton City Centre, in close proximity to the new Wolverhampton Interchange, providing excellent access to rail, tram and bus transport for members of the public. The site is currently owned by the City of Wolverhampton Council and operates as a public car park. The proposal will include re-providing a 400-space multi-storey car park within the development.
